  4. Yes, Union Model managed to get the Revell Datsun molds and make a few kits back in the 80's. The BRE 510, Z, and the Brock Buster where done by them. For a long time, they where one of the only available issues of these kits, the other being Lodela of Mexico and their re-issues of these kits. I only know this because I am Datsun Nerd! LOL!

  10. That will depend if Prudhomme, his daughter, agrees to it. His licensed items are controlled by his daughter, and for quite some time, she held on to it pretty tight. Slixx made every decal out there for McEwen, but nothing for Prudhomme, because she said no. Things have changed a bit, and hopefully they allow Revell to use his name again.

  20. The MPC version came with the 4 Cyl. L Type engine.
  21. Actually, it was quite popular. It had a great run from 1973 to 1979 The Revell version did not come in a stock version at all. It has the same generic chassis as the Ford Courier and the Chevy Luv, and it is way out of scale. The MPC kit is the closest to an accurate 620 as it gets. Sans the Gasser and Monster truck versions.
